What does Mercury retrograde mean?

Before we get into the details - what does retrograde mean? The word generally means moving backward, reversing direction or returning to a previous state.

But in astrology, 'Mercury retrograde' refers to a period when, due to an optical illusion, the planet Mercury appears to move backwards across the sky as seen from Earth.

Usually, planets move from west to east across the night sky - meaning if you look at the sky two nights in a row, the planets should have moved a little further east.

However, during periods of apparent retrograde motion, planets appear to do the opposite. So, when people refer to Mercury in retrograde, they're referring to the period when Mercury appears to move from east to west across the sky. During this time, the planet appears to be moving backwards, though this isn't actually the case…

What causes Mercury retrograde?

All planets actually have periods of retrograde motion, caused by the different speeds at which they move around the sun.

You see, planets are never actually moving backwards, it simply looks like they are (which is why some prefer the term apparent retrograde motion). Think of two cars on the motorway, as one speeds past the other, the slower car appears to be going backwards, this is similar to planets in retrograde.

Mercury orbits the sun, completing a loop every 88 days. The Earth, on the other hand, takes 365.25 days to orbit the sun - meaning Mercury overtakes us three to four times per year.

During these periods, it can appear as though Mercury is going backwards - giving rise to the phrase Mercury retrograde.

Why does Mercury retrograde appear on socials?

An young woman looks down at her phone unhappily

Mercury retrograde has been observed and documented by humans for thousands of years, but recent years have seen it take on new life across social media.

Mercury takes its name from the Roman God - you guessed it - Mercury. In mythology, Mercury was a messenger god responsible for communication between the divine and mortal realms. As a result, the planet Mercury has taken on a strong astrological significance in matters of communication.

Astrologists believe that in periods of Mercury retrograde, communication technologies (like phones) are more likely to break, miscommunication is more likely, and relationships are liable to break down. Astrology followers view Mercury retrograde as a period of turbulence that should be approached with caution.

Astrology, which is the pseudoscientific belief that the position of stars and planets can affect events on Earth, is pretty popular on socials - which probably accounts for the spike in posts you might see around Mercury retrograde.

And it doesn't just end at posts, you can get Mercury retrograde T-shirts, tote bags and even pillows!

The term, if not the belief, has also spread beyond normal astrological circles - with celebs like Taylor Swift mentioning the phenomenon in past interviews.

When does Mercury appear to be in retrograde?

Mercury overtakes Earth in its orbit around the Sun about three or four times a year, which means Mercury appears in retrograde the same number of times.

2026 brought with it three instances of Mercury retrograde, two of which have already occurred:

  • 26 February - 20 March
  • 29 June - 23 July
  • 24 October - 13 November

How does Mercury retrograde affect you?

For the most part, it won't have any effect on your daily life.

Despite popular myths in astrology saying that Mercury retrograde can have all sorts of negative effects - like grounding planes and breaking smartphones - there's no scientific backing for this.

Astrology itself is a pseudoscience, functioning more as a system of belief than anything else. So, we wouldn't waste too much time worrying about Mercury retrograde, as there's no scientific evidence that the position of Mercury - or any other planet, for that matter - has any predictable effect on human behaviour.

Do other planets go into retrograde?

There are eight planets in our solar system - celestial bodies that orbit a star and can be made up of rock, gas or a mix of both.

Mercury is one of four inner planets - it is a terrestrial planet, or rock planet, which is closer to the Sun so generally warmer. Mercury is the planet in our solar system that is closest to the Sun.

But an outer planet is further away from the Sun and generally colder. There are also four of those, known as gas giants.

But do all planets go into retrograde? The answer is yes they can - but the retrograde cycle will differ depending on the planet. So if you hear of, say, a Mars retrograde, Saturn retrograde or a Venus retrograde, don't dismiss it!

In case you wondered, the Sun and the Moon never go into retrograde. It is only our planets that appear to move backwards, which is known as planetary retrograde.
